Package: syslog-ng-mod-lua (0.6.2-0.1)

Enhanced system logging daemon (Lua destination)

syslog-ng is an enhanced log daemon, supporting a wide range of input and output methods: syslog, unstructured text, message queues, databases (SQL and NoSQL alike) and more.

Key features:

 * receive and send RFC3164 and RFC5424 style syslog messages
 * work with any kind of unstructured data
 * receive and send JSON formatted messages
 * classify and structure logs with builtin parsers (csv-parser(),
   db-parser(), etc.)
 * normalize, crunch and process logs as they flow through the system
 * hand on messages for further processing using message queues (like
   AMQP), files or databases (like PostgreSQL or MongoDB).

This package provides the Lua destination, allowing one to write destination drivers without having to touch C, in Lua. It also includes the monitor() source driver, which allows one to write Lua functions that periodically trigger and emit log messages.
